Conspiracy to defame the government by taking the help of Supreme Court.
BJP state spokesperson Bijendra Nehra accused the Congress and said that Congressmen are repeatedly filing petitions to stop the Panchayat elections. The living example of which is the petition filed against the Panchayat elections in the Supreme Court by Deepkaran, son of former MLA Karan Dalal from Palwal.
In a statement issued to the press, Nehra said that the Haryana government had told the Election Commission to hold the panchayat elections before September 31. But the dark shadow of Congress is repeatedly trying to stop the Panchayat elections. He said that the Punjab and Haryana High Court had made it clear that a provision has been made under the Haryana Panchayati Raj Act that only those Gram Panchayats in which the Scheduled Caste population is more than 10 percent would be reserved.
Congress intends to stop the election
Nehra accused the Congress and said that even before this, the Haryana government was in favor of holding elections. But the intention of the Congress has been to stall the elections. The Congress party has deliberately worked to delay the Panchayat elections by filing 14 petitions in the High Court by its people. It is clear from this that the Congress does not want Panchayat elections to be held in Haryana. The Congress party is afraid that it will get a bad defeat in the Panchayat elections too, so it is trying to postpone the Panchayat elections by repeatedly applying in the court by its people. When the time comes, the people of the state will definitely give this answer.
